
A bill that would criminalize abortions after six weeks of gestation — even in cases of rape or incest – is headed to Gov. Burgum’s desk.
The North Dakota Senate today (Wed) voted 42-to-5 in favor of the amended measure that was passed by the House 76-to-14 on Monday.
Of the four Democrats in the Senate, only Tim Mathern of Fargo voted for the bill.
Two Republicans voted no: Sen. Karen Krebsbach of Minot and Sen. Judy Lee of Fargo.
